CARING FOR CINTIQ

Keep the Grip Pen and your Cintiq LCD screen surface clean. Dust and dirt particles can stick to the
pen and cause excessive wear to the display screen surface. Regular cleaning will help to prolong the
life of your LCD screen surface and pen. Keep Cintiq, the Cintiq stand, and the Grip Pen in a clean, dry
place and avoid extremes in temperature. Room temperature is best. Cintiq, the Cintiq stand, and the
Grip Pen are not made to come apart (except where specifically indicated for removal and replacement
of the pen's DuoSwitch). Taking apart the product will void your warranty.
Important: Take care never to spill liquids onto the pen display or pen. Be especially careful of
getting the display, tablet ExpressKeys, Touch Strips, or pen buttons, tip, and eraser wet – they
contain sensitive electronic parts that will fail if liquids enter them.

CLEANING

To clean the Cintiq casing, the Cintiq display stand, or the Grip Pen, use a soft, damp cloth; you can
also dampen the cloth using a very mild soap diluted with water. Do not use paint thinner, benzine,
alcohol, or other solvents to clean the unit casing or pen.
To clean the display screen, use an anti-static cloth or a slightly damp cloth. When cleaning, apply only
a light amount of pressure to the display screen and do not make the surface wet. Do not use detergent
to clean the display screen; this may damage the coating on the screen. Please note that damage of
this kind is not covered by the manufacturer's warranty.
